Summary
The documentation is mostly cross-platform, using Azure CLI and shell syntax compatible with both Linux and Windows. However, there is a notable Windows bias in the 'Deploy a template' section, where the primary link for creating ARM templates is to a Visual Studio Code tutorial with PowerShell tabs highlighted, and no mention of Linux-native editors or shell environments. The reference to PowerShell in the link text and lack of explicit Linux alternatives suggests a subtle Windows-first approach.
Recommendations
  • Provide equal emphasis on Linux-native tools and editors (e.g., VS Code on Linux, Vim, nano) for ARM template creation.
  • Ensure that referenced tutorials and quickstarts include Bash/Linux shell tabs or examples alongside PowerShell.
  • Avoid mentioning Windows tools or environments (like PowerShell) exclusively or first; instead, present both Windows and Linux options in parallel.
  • Add explicit notes clarifying that all Azure CLI examples work on both Windows and Linux, and provide troubleshooting tips for common platform-specific issues.
